Transaction 90a574fc715c891af35608cf86e21e61ca5a86c8bdf3f8f3177761102b5d88c6

1 Input
2 Outputs
  • 90a574fc715c891af35608cf86e21e61ca5a86c8bdf3f8f3177761102b5d88c6:0
  • value  8355973
    address  32YcRJu8tdUJGJrQaBS8jEdGa2N1rVxF9D
  • 90a574fc715c891af35608cf86e21e61ca5a86c8bdf3f8f3177761102b5d88c6:1
  • value  40663
    address  17vQoE9NS2dQ3NsTqjrtY5pP7ddubBKHc1